Cyber Authority: Iran recently attacked over 10 entities in Israel, including Assaf Harofeh Hospital

|
The National Cyber Authority announced a wave of Iranian cyberattacks on companies and essential organizations in Israel in recent weeks, including companies providing computing services to many businesses in the economy. More than ten private companies were subject to some level of attack recently, most of them attacked through their connections to digital service companies for business entities, which constitute a link in supply chains. Among the organizations affected in the wave of attacks was also Shamir Assaf Harofeh Hospital, where attackers attempted to disrupt operations. The investigation revealed that in many attacks, the perpetrators exploited stolen or leaked usernames and passwords to infiltrate systems.
